SIGN UP!!

Need to get some words in? The Weekend Writing Marathon (WWM) is a writing challenge designed to help you do just that. You set your own writing goal for the weekend and work to achieve it before reporting back to the group on Sunday night.


How do I participate?

1. Reply to this post with your weekend writing plans–be as specific (or not) as you’d like.

2. Start writing on Friday 12:01 am local time. Work to meet your goal by Sunday night at 11:59 pm local time. You can work on whatever you want during this time.

3. Post your accomplishments to the Finish Line post at the end of the weekend (even if you didn’t reach your goal).


How do I report my accomplishments?

A Finish Line post will go up on Sunday. Reblog that post with your final word count/accomplished goal(s) by Monday at midnight local time. Totals from the weekend will be posted on Tuesday.

This challenge is currently running on 2 platforms: pillowfort, and dreamwidth. If you sign up on this platform, please respond to the Finish Line post on this platform.

Today's theme is specific scenarios. Prompts that describe a detailed situation for characters to react to or experience. They set the stage for the fic but leave plenty of room for interpretation, things like “stuck in an elevator during a power outage,” “accidentally switched phones,” or “snowed in at the airport.” These work well because they spark instant ‘what if’ ideas without locking the writer into one exact storyline.
